Navigating Urban Landscape Challenges

Urban parenting presents unique mobility challenges that significantly impact stroller selection criteria. Research from the Urban Mobility Institute indicates that city-dwelling parents navigate an average of 3.2 km daily with their strollers, encountering multiple obstacles including public transportation access, narrow store aisles, and limited apartment storage space. The compact design of the bugaboo bee 6 addresses some of these concerns, but parents must consider how it integrates with other essential gear like the britax romer car seat for complete mobility solutions.

Public transportation compatibility remains a critical factor, with metropolitan transit systems requiring strollers to fold quickly and occupy minimal space during peak hours. The bugaboo bee 6's one-handed folding mechanism provides an advantage in these situations, though some parents report challenges with the folded dimensions when combining it with additional accessories. Psychological factors heavily influence premium product decisions, with many parents associating higher prices with superior safety and quality. Marketing research from the Consumer Psychology Association indicates that 57% of first-time parents experience "premium product anxiety," fearing that selecting more affordable options might compromise their child's comfort or safety. This emotional dynamic often overshadows practical considerations, leading to decisions that prioritize perceived status over documented performance differences.

Long-term usability represents another critical financial consideration. While the bugaboo bee 6 offers extendable functionality through additional seats and accessories, parents must realistically assess whether they will utilize these features throughout the stroller's lifespan. The compatibility with products like the britax romer car seat provides practical value during the infant stage, but the ongoing investment in brand-specific accessories may limit flexibility as children grow and needs evolve.
